Speed & Time
If the ratio of the speeds of A and B to cover a distance of 200 m is 3:4, then the ratio of the time taken to cover the same distance is ___________?
Since speed is inversely proportional to time for the same distance, the ratio of times taken is the inverse of the ratio of speeds. Given speeds ratio is 3:4, so time ratio is 4:3.

Percentage
How much is 60% of 50 greater than 40% of 30?
60% of 50 is 0.6 × 50 = 30, and 40% of 30 is 0.4 × 30 = 12. The difference is 30 - 12 = 18, so 60% of 50 is 18 greater than 40% of 30.

Percentage
96% of the population of a village is 23040. What is the total population of the village?
Given that 96% of the population is 23040, the total population can be found by dividing 23040 by 0.96. This calculation is 23040 ÷ 0.96 = 24000. Therefore, the total population of the village is 24000, which corresponds to option B.

Ratio
Four singers, five dancers, and three comperes divide an amount of Rs.130000 among themselves such that three comperes get as much as two dancers and three dancers get as much as two singers. Find the amount received by a singer.
Let the amount received by a singer be x. Then, 3 dancers get as much as 2 singers, so 3 dancers = 2 singers = 2x, thus 1 dancer = 2x/3. Similarly, 3 comperes get as much as 2 dancers, so 3 comperes = 2 dancers = 2 * (2x/3) = 4x/3, thus 1 compere = (4x/3)/3 = 4x/9. Total amount = 4 singers * x + 5 dancers * (2x/3) + 3 comperes * (4x/9) = 4x + (10x/3) + (12x/9) = 4x + 3.333x + 1.333x = 8.666x = Rs.130000. So, x = 130000 / 8.666 = Rs.15000.

Percentage
The number of seats available for Biology and Computer Science in a school is in the ratio 5:8. They are to be increased by 30% and 25%, respectively. Find the new ratio.
The original ratio of seats is 5:8. Increasing 5 by 30% gives 5 × 1.3 = 6.5, and increasing 8 by 25% gives 8 × 1.25 = 10. The new ratio is 6.5:10, which simplifies to 13:20.

Time & Distance
Taimoor left for his school at 6 am on foot and walked at the rate of 2 km/h. After reaching his school, he found it was closed and immediately turned back, walking back home at 3 km/h. If he reached home at 9 am, find the distance between his school and his home.
Taimoor walked from 6 am to 9 am, so total time is 3 hours. Let the distance to school be x km. Time to school = x/2 hours, time back = x/3 hours. Total time = x/2 + x/3 = 3 hours. Solving gives x = 7.2 km.

Ratio
M:N = 3:4, N:O = 5:7, and O:P = 7:9. Then M:P = _________?
To find M:P, first express all ratios with a common term. Given M:N = 3:4, N:O = 5:7, and O:P = 7:9, we align N and O terms: N is 4 in first ratio and 5 in second, so multiply first ratio by 5 and second by 4 to get M:N = 15:20 and N:O = 20:28. Similarly, O:P = 7:9, multiply by 4 to get O:P = 28:36. Now, M:P = 15:36, which simplifies to 5:12. Hence, M:P = 5/12.

Algebra
The sum of the squares of three numbers is 138, while the sum of their products taken two at a time is 131. Their sum is: ___________?
Let the three numbers be a, b, and c. We know that a² + b² + c² = 138 and ab + bc + ca = 131. Using the identity (a + b + c)² = a² + b² + c² + 2(ab + bc + ca), we get (a + b + c)² = 138 + 2*131 = 138 + 262 = 400. Therefore, a + b + c = √400 = 20.
